WASHINGTON—The Heritage Foundation announced Wednesday that Delano Squires has joined the organization as a research fellow with Heritage’s DeVos Center for Life, Religion and Family. In this new position, Squires will focus on policies that support life, marriage, the family, and religious liberty. He will also conduct research with a particular emphasis on the importance of fatherhood.

Squires has been a consistent voice on marriage and family issues for many years. He has worked as a contributor to BlazeTV’s “Fearless with Jason Whitlock,” and has written extensively about race, religion, the family, and culture for The Federalist, Black and Married with Kids, and The Root.

Squires recently joined Heritage Foundation President Kevin Roberts’ podcast, “The Kevin Roberts Show,” to talk about the crisis of fatherhood and why government cannot replace fathers. Listen to that episode here.
